2015 Gathering of Eagles

Commemorating the 60th Anniversary of the First Flight of the U-2 and the 25th anniversary of the SR-71 Smithsonian Speed Run, legendary SR-71 and U-2 pilots shared a few of their experiences during the 27th Annual Gathering of Eagles at the Hunter Pavilion, Lancaster, Calif. Hosted by the Flight Test Historical Foundation, the annual gala raises funds to support moving the museum to a new location outside of the restricted area of Edwards AFB.

Eagle Honorees for 2015 included BMLC’s own U-2 and SR-71 pilot, Lt. Col. Tony Bevacqua, Retired Lockheed U-2 Chief Test Pilot Lt. Col David Kerzie, Current Lockheed U-2 Chief Test Pilot Col. Robert Rowe, Col. Louis Setter, and USAF SR-71 test pilot Lt. Col. Ed Yeilding. All are USAF retired.
